How To Write Resume For Computer Systems Manager
- Highlight your technical expertise and experience in cloud computing, server virtualization, and network management.
- Quantify your accomplishments with specific metrics and results, such as reduced downtime or increased efficiency.
- Showcase your leadership abilities and experience in managing teams and collaborating with stakeholders.
- Emphasize your commitment to continuous learning and professional development in the field of IT.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Computer Systems Manager
What are the primary responsibilities of a Computer Systems Manager?
Computer Systems Managers are responsible for managing and maintaining complex IT infrastructures, including servers, networks, and data centers. They ensure the reliability, performance, and security of these systems, and work closely with business stakeholders to align IT strategies with business objectives.
What skills and qualifications are required to become a Computer Systems Manager?
Computer Systems Managers typically have a Master’s or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science or a related field. They also possess strong technical expertise in cloud computing, server virtualization, network management, data center operations, system automation, and IT security. Excellent communication and leadership skills are also essential.
What is the career outlook for Computer Systems Managers?
The career outlook for Computer Systems Managers is expected to grow in the coming years. As businesses increasingly rely on technology, the demand for skilled IT professionals who can manage and maintain complex IT infrastructures will continue to increase.
What are the typical salary expectations for Computer Systems Managers?
The salary expectations for Computer Systems Managers vary depending on experience, location, and industry. However, according to recent surveys, the average salary for Computer Systems Managers in the United States is around $120,000 per year.
What are the common challenges faced by Computer Systems Managers?
Computer Systems Managers face a number of challenges in their day-to-day work. These challenges include managing complex IT infrastructures, ensuring the security and reliability of systems, and keeping up with the latest technological advancements.
What are the key qualities of a successful Computer Systems Manager?
Successful Computer Systems Managers possess a strong technical foundation, excellent communication and leadership skills, and a commitment to continuous learning. They are also able to work independently and as part of a team, and are able to prioritize and manage multiple tasks effectively.
What are the opportunities for career advancement for Computer Systems Managers?
Computer Systems Managers have a number of opportunities for career advancement. With experience, they can move into more senior management roles, such as IT Director or CIO. They can also specialize in a particular area of IT, such as cloud computing or cybersecurity.
